您的位置:程序门 -> .net技术 -> c#



vs2003 c#播放flash有问题


[收藏此页] [打印本页]选择字色:背景色:字体:[][][]


vs2003 c#播放flash有问题
发表于:2007-01-25 00:01:48 楼主
在vs2003   c#页面中,插入如下代码:
<object   classid= "clsid:d27cdb6e-ae6d-11cf-96b8-444553540000 "   codebase= "http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0 "   width= "320 "   height= "280 "   viewastext>
<param   name= "movie "   value= "flash/playonemoviefinal.swf "   />
<param   name= "quality "   value= "high "   />
<param   name= "menu "   value= "false ">
<embed   src= "flash/playonemoviefinal.swf "   quality= "high "   pluginspage= "http://www.macromedia.com/go/getflashplayer "   type= "application/x-shockwave-flash "   width= "320 "   height= "280 "> </embed>
</object>
运行后,flash部分是灰色,什么提示也没有,在dw上是好的,这是为什么啊?
发表于:2007-01-25 00:02:011楼 得分:0
自己先顶一个!
发表于:2007-01-25 13:24:072楼 得分:0
楼主你先做一个html的空白页,用相对路径把flash插入进去,在你的程序里,使用webbrowser控件加载这个html页。但是这里面有问题,也就是右键的问题,你在flash或html页上点右键会有菜单出来,需要控制一下,很简单,第一是修改flash原码,然后是修改html页,加javascript脚本控制。这样就没有问题了,楼主自己试试,网上控制菜单的代码很多的。
发表于:2007-01-25 13:45:223楼 得分:0
<object   codebase= "http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0 "
height= "60 "   width= "778 "   classid= "clsid:d27cdb6e-ae6d-11cf-96b8-444553540000 "   viewastext>
<param   name= "_cx "   value= "20585 ">
<param   name= "_cy "   value= "1588 ">
<param   name= "flashvars "   value= " ">
<param   name= "movie "   value= "ad/dxsbn060315.swf ">
<param   name= "src "   value= "ad/dxsbn060315.swf ">
<param   name= "wmode "   value= "window ">
<param   name= "play "   value= "-1 ">
<param   name= "loop "   value= "-1 ">
<param   name= "quality "   value= "high ">
<param   name= "salign "   value= " ">
<param   name= "menu "   value= "-1 ">
<param   name= "base "   value= " ">
<param   name= "allowscriptaccess "   value= " ">
<param   name= "scale "   value= "showall ">
<param   name= "devicefont "   value= "0 ">
<param   name= "embedmovie "   value= "0 ">
<param   name= "bgcolor "   value= " ">
<param   name= "swremote "   value= " ">
<param   name= "moviedata "   value= " ">
<param   name= "seamlesstabbing "   value= "1 ">
<param   name= "profile "   value= "0 ">
<param   name= "profileaddress "   value= " ">
<param   name= "profileport "   value= "0 ">
<embed   src= "ad/dxsbn060315.swf "   quality= "high "   pluginspage= "http://www.macromedia.com/go/getflashplayer "
type= "application/x-shockwave-flash "   width= "778 "   height= "60 ">   </embed>
</object>
//费那事干吗,直接给你一个得了!
发表于:2007-01-28 19:41:564楼 得分:0
我用flvplayback组件播放flv文件,dw下可以,但到c#下后,flvplayback组件显示不出来,这是什么原因啊?


快速检索

最新资讯
热门点击